Yang, Hong – TESL Canada Journal, 2006
This article reports an empirical study of classroom observation of two general English lessons that examined the effects of teachers' referential questions on learners' responses in two ESL classrooms. The study found that in both classes, the teachers asked many more referential questions than display questions, contrary to earlier findings.…

Cooke, David – TESL Canada Journal, 2001
Results of a survey of English-as-a-Second-Language (ESL) in Auckland, New Zealand, in light of the pervasive restructuring of society and education in the last 15 years, suggest that the lives of immigrants are difficult and precarious. Many realize that their previous training and experience are unsuitable for their chosen occupations, and their…
